Understanding Roofing Felt
Roofing felt is a key player in the construction industry, providing a barrier against the elements and prolonging the lifespan of roofing systems. Below are some insights into the benefits and science behind roofing felt.
Roofing felt acts as a moisture barrier, preventing water from seeping into the structure, which is crucial in rain-prone regions like USA.
Studies indicate that synthetic roofing felt outperforms traditional felt due to its enhanced water resistance and UV protection.
Research shows that using roofing felt can prolong the life of your roofing materials, ultimately saving homeowners money on repairs and replacements.
Many modern roofing felts are lighter and easier to handle than older products, leading to lower labor costs during installation.
Synthetic roofing options are less susceptible to mold and mildew growth, ensuring a healthier environment in your home over time.
